SEOUL - Lee Hyun-il thrilled his home crowd with a battling victory over world champion Lin Dan of China in the final of the Korean Open Super Series on Sunday.

In a classic 71-minute encounter, Lee recovered from a terrible start to triumph 4-21 23-21 25-23.

The victory was revenge for Lee who has a modest record against Lin and most notably lost to him in the final of the All England championships in Birmingham in 2006.

There was also a surprise in the women's singles final where unseeded Zhou Mi from Hong Kong ousted third seed Lu Lan of China 21-18 15-21 21-15 in a match lasting just under an hour.

The Korean tournament was the second in this year's 12-strong Super Series. The next event is the All England in March and the Series finals are in December.
